    Imagine this scenario: you’ve rented a storage unit to keep your prized possessions safe and secure. But have you thought about whether they’re protected in case of theft, damage, or disaster? That’s where renters insurance for storage units comes into play. In this guide, we’ll delve into the frequently asked questions about renters insurance for storage units in GEICO, providing you with the knowledge you need to safeguard your belongings.

    Understanding the Basics

    Before diving into the specifics, let’s brush up on the basics of renters insurance. This type of insurance is created to protect tenants against financial losses resulting from theft, damage, or liability claims. It typically covers personal belongings both inside and outside the home, including items stored in a rented storage unit.

    What Does Renters Insurance Cover?

    One of the first questions on your mind might be, “What does renters insurance cover when it comes to storage units?” Well, the good news is that most standard renters insurance policies extend coverage to items stored off-premises, including storage units. This means that your belongings are protected against perils such as theft, fire, vandalism, and certain natural disasters.

    Understanding Coverage Limits

    While renters insurance offers valuable protection, it’s essential to understand the coverage limits and exclusions. Typically, insurance policies have limits on the total amount of coverage for personal property, as well as sub-limits for specific categories such as jewelry, electronics, and collectibles. It’s crucial to review your policy carefully to ensure that your storage unit contents are adequately covered.

    Additional Coverage Options

    If you have high-value items or belongings that exceed the standard coverage limits, you may want to consider additional coverage options. Some insurance companies offer endorsements or riders that can be added to your policy to raise coverage for specific items. Alternatively, you can opt for a separate storage insurance policy to assure comprehensive protection for your stored belongings.

    Choosing the Right Policy

    When selecting renters insurance for your storage unit, it’s vital to shop around and compare the quotes from multiple insurers. Look for a policy that offers the coverage limits and deductibles that meet your needs, as well as competitive premiums. Consider factors like the insurer’s reputation, customer service, and claims process when making your decision.

    Navigating the Claims Process

    In the unfortunate event that you require to file a claim for damage/loss of your stored belongings, it’s essential to understand the claims process. Contact your insurance company as soon as possible to report the incident and provide any necessary documentation, such as a police report or inventory of the damaged items. Your insurer will guide you through the process and work to resolve your claim promptly.

    Tips for Maximizing Coverage

    To ensure maximum protection for your stored belongings, there are several proactive steps you can take. First, create an inventory of the items in your storage unit, including photos and receipts where possible. This documentation will be invaluable in the event of a claim. Additionally, consider investing in security measures like the locks, alarms, and surveillance cameras to deter theft and vandalism.
